Криптография: Что Это Такое И Сферы Применения
Они обеспечивают шифрование сообщений и их цифровую подпись, что гарантирует конфиденциальность и аутентичность. Сегодня криптография используется повсеместно, от электронной почты до банковских систем. Термин «криптографические вычисления» охватывает широкий диапазон технологий, в том числе безопасные многосторонние вычисления, гомоморфное шифрование и шифрование с возможностью поиска. Эта подпись является уникальной для пары документ-частный ключ и может прикрепляться к документу и проверяться с использованием открытого ключа лица, ставящего подпись. Двумя распространенными алгоритмами цифровой подписи являются RSA с вероятностной схемой подписи (RSA-PSS) и алгоритм цифровой подписи (DSA). Одним из самых популярных блочных шифров является расширенный стандарт шифрования (Advanced Encryption Standard https://sfedor.ru/kak-rabotayut-rulonnye-shtory/, AES).
Хотя криптография ассоциируется в первую очередь с достижениями современной науки, технология используется человечеством уже несколько тысячелетий. Если раньше ее применяли преимущественно государственные деятели и секретные службы, сейчас криптография присутствует в жизни любого человека с доступом в интернет. На реализацию этих сложнейших, с точки зрения обывателя, криптографических операций уходят доли секунды. Наш мир с каждым днем становится все более связанным, как в реальном, так и в виртуальном пространстве.
Что Такое Хэширование В Криптографии?
Примером такого шифрования является метод DES (Data Encryption Standard) или AES (Advanced Encryption Standard). В 2009 году появилась первая в мире криптовалюта, полностью основанная на шифрах и неподконтрольная ни одному государству в мире — биткоин 15. О его создателях известно только то, что протокол криптовалюты опубликовал человек или группа людей под псевдонимом Сатоси Накамото. Биткоин, как и некоторые другие криптовалюты, в том числе созданная позже Ethereum, базируется на криптографии эллиптических кривых. Безопасность транзакций обеспечивает асимметричное шифрование через два ключа — публичный и приватный. С развитием интернета в 1990-е годы встал вопрос защиты данных простых людей.
Главный метод современной криптографии — шифрование, которое превращает информацию в код, поддающийся расшифровке только с помощью подходящего ключа. То есть в основе криптографии лежит та же идея, что и у секретных языков, которые придумывают дети, чтобы запутать взрослых. В ситуации, когда код знает только отправитель и получатель информации, передаваемые данные остаются для остальных непереводимым набором символов.
Конфиденциальность И Предотвращение Утечки Данных В Социальных Сетях
- Современные алгоритмы используют сложные математические вычисления и один или несколько ключей шифрования.
- Это особенно актуально для таких чувствительных данных, как номера счетов и суммы платежей.
- Они используются для проверки целостности данных и защиты паролей.
- Криптовалюта — это цифровая валюта, существующая исключительно онлайн, без физического выражения, основанная на технологии блокчейн и работающая без участия банков или государства.
В стандарте ISO/IEC описаны методы (симметричные и асимметричные) для предоставления услуг по обеспечению неотказуемости. Основы асимметричного шифрования были выдвинуты американскими криптографами Уитфилдом Диффи и Мартином Хеллманом. Они предположили, что ключи можно использовать парами — ключ шифрования и ключ дешифрования. Поэтому суть метода заключается в том, что зашифрованная при помощи секретного ключа информация может быть расшифрована только при помощи открытого и наоборот.
История Криптографии
Четвёртый период — с середины до 70-х годов XX века — период перехода к математической криптографии. В работе Шеннона появляются строгие математические определения количества информации, https://sfedor.ru/category/stroitelstvo/ передачи данных, энтропии, функций шифрования. Обязательным этапом создания шифра считается изучение его уязвимости для различных известных атак — линейного и дифференциального криптоанализа. Однако до 1975 года криптография оставалась «классической», или же, более корректно, криптографией с секретным ключом.
Ведущие исследователи из Стэнфордского университета, Массачусетского технологического института и компаний в области телекоммуникаций стали пионерами в этой области. По завершении военных действий Уинстон Черчилль донес королю Георгу VI, что именно благодаря проекту Тьюринга страна сумела получить конкурентное преимущество над противником. Этот успех и созданные после него вычислительные устройства, аналогичные современным компьютерам, положили начало новой эры в вычислительной технологии. Несмотря на то, что криптография в первую очередь ассоциируется с достижениями современной науки, ее использование тянется через несколько тысячелетий истории.
Криптография С Симметричным Ключом
Банковские системы и онлайн-платежи широко используют криптографию для защиты финансовых данных. Протоколы, такие как 3D Secure, шифруют информацию о транзакциях и аутентифицируют пользователей. Код аутентификации сообщения (MAC) – это симметричная версия цифровой подписи. При использовании MAC две или больше сторон совместно используют ключ. Одна сторона создает тег MAC, который является симметричной версией цифровой подписи, и прикрепляет его к документу.